Kalki 2898 AD: India's First AI-Powered Car, Bujji

The eagerly anticipated movie, Kalki 2898 AD, has finally premiered in theatres, featuring a star-studded cast including Amitabh Bachchan and Kamal Hassan. Among the standout characters is Bujji, a futuristic AI-powered electric vehicle, which has captured the audience's imagination. Bujji blends the wildly imaginative elements of Mad Max with the iconic world of Transformers, even attracting the attention of Anand Mahindra, Chairperson of Mahindra, who couldn't resist taking this futuristic vehicle out for a spin. Here’s everything you need to know about superstar Prabhas’ new ride.

Meet the Incredible Mr. Bujji

Sci-fi enthusiasts of Star Trek and Star Wars will feel right at home with Bujji's larger-than-life design. The vehicle boasts three gargantuan tires, two in the front and one spherical at the rear, complemented by an all-glass dome, ensuring an unparalleled road presence. Bujji’s impressive stature is further accentuated by its bulging biceps, with the front two 34.5-inch tires made by Ceat, while the alloy wheels are specially imported.

Powered by twin electric motors, this rear-wheel-drive beast has a total power output of 126 bhp (94 kW) and an astonishing 9,800 Nm of torque. This figure is no typo; it's truly mind-boggling. The heart of Bujji is a 47 kWh battery pack featuring battery swapping technology.

Bujji's Dimensions

Bujji measures 6,075 mm in length, 3,380 mm in width, and 2,186 mm in height. This makes the EV sci-fi vehicle over 500mm longer than the limousine Mercedes-Benz Maybach S-Class, nearly as wide as two Toyota Fortuner, and towering over the Toyota Land Cruiser.

The Origin of Bujji

Nag Ashwin, the director of Kalki 2898 AD, expressed his gratitude to Mahindra and Jayem Automotives for their pivotal role in bringing Bujji to life. The collaborative efforts of engineers from Mahindra Research Valley and Jayem were instrumental in constructing this formidable machine. Consequently, the twin electric motors powering Bujji are supplied by Mahindra.
